The new year is off to a good start for shelter animals – ALDI collected donations
ALDI collected pet food in cooperation with its customers and the Ant Society, thereby providing assistance to the approximately 6,100 residents of many animal shelters.
The basic element of ALDI’s social responsibility is environmental awareness and social sensitivity, and it has been doing important social work with its fundraising for years, an essential part of which is the role related to the welfare of animals.
During the New Year’s Eve period, from December 28, 2023 to January 3, 2024, ALDI organized a national pet food collection campaign together with the Ant Community. The Ant Community has been helping shelters and animal protection organizations since 2010, and primarily provides material assistance to the hundreds of organizations associated with them.
During the campaign, ALDI customers in any of the stores in Hungary had the opportunity to support animal protection organizations in difficult situations – in the form of pet food.
